The Technical Context of "720p" The inclusion of "720p" in the file name is a relic of internet video history. Standing for 1280x720 pixels, 720p was the industry standard for High Definition (HD) video in the late 2000s and early 2010s. For many years, this resolution offered a significant upgrade from Standard Definition (480p), providing a widescreen aspect ratio (16:9) and sharper image clarity that became the benchmark for online streaming and digital downloads.

Bitrate vs. Resolution While 720p defines the pixel count, the "MP4" container format usually utilizes the H.264 codec. In the era when "720p" was the standard label for high-quality web video, the bitrate—the amount of data processed per second—was actually the primary determinant of video quality. A high-resolution file with a low bitrate would look pixelated during motion, whereas a 720p file with a high bitrate often provided a smoother, cleaner viewing experience, particularly for fast-paced content.

The Shift to Higher Standards Today, 720p is largely considered "Entry HD" or even low quality by modern standards. The industry has shifted decisively toward 1080p (Full HD) and 4K (Ultra HD). As internet speeds increased and storage costs decreased, the demand for higher resolutions grew. Platforms that once hosted 720p as their premium offering now reserve it for lower-tier streaming options to save bandwidth on mobile devices.

This report outlines the essential guidelines and regulations for hosting an indoor pool party at a college facility. University aquatic centers operate under strict safety and hygiene protocols to protect students and the facility infrastructure. Core Safety Regulations

Lifeguard Supervision: Parties are strictly prohibited unless the pool is officially open and a certified lifeguard is on duty. All guests must follow the lifeguard's instructions at all times.

Entry Requirements: Valid student identification is typically required for entry. For private events, organizers (who often must be over 21) must sign in all guests, including non-swimmers.

Behavioral Standards: Horseplay, running on the pool deck, and "suicide dives" or backflips are universally banned to prevent slips and falls on wet surfaces.

Breath-Holding: Voluntary hyperventilation or extended breath-holding contests are prohibited due to the risk of shallow-water blackout. Hygiene and Attire Protocols

Cleansing Showers: All swimmers are required to take a cleansing shower before entering the water. This removes skin oils and bacteria that interfere with the pool's chemical balance.

Approved Swimwear: Proper aquatic attire (swimsuits/trunks with liners) is mandatory. Street clothes, including cotton t-shirts, basketball shorts, and denim cut-offs, are banned because their fibers can clog filtration systems.
